Coimbatore: A woman, who had delivered a baby two days ago in a government hospital here, tested positive for H1N1.

According to hospital sources, Kala of Puliyakulam in the city was admitted for delivery a couple of days ago.

The new born baby was below normal weight and put in incubator, even as Kala was suffering from fever, which continued to be high yesterday.

The doctors attending to her took swab test, which was found positive, they said.

The woman was immediately shifted to isolation ward, where 11 persons, including two children, were already being treated.

So far, 110 swine flu patients, from across threee neighbouring districts, were treated in the hospital, amid the death of six since January.
